One more considerable area of emphasis for the Chinese robotics market is the boosting application of collaborative robots, typically referred to as cobots. These robots are developed to work alongside human drivers in a common office, doing a series of tasks from material handling to setting up help. The application of cobots represents a shift in just how services in China view robotic modern technology; instead than seeing robots as a replacement for human labor, companies are starting to harness them as partners that can improve and augment human capacities security. The rise of cobots in China can be credited to their capability to simplify intricate tasks, making it possible for business to make best use of workforce efficiency without the demand for substantial re-training or workflow redesign.

Diving deeper into certain applications, the assimilation of robotics in new energy vehicle (NEV) production plants within China offers a brilliant image of how technology is shaping the future of markets essential for lasting growth. Robotics help manage the elaborate procedures entailed, from battery setting up and vehicle paint to detailed robotic welding tasks, all required to meet the surging demand for new energy automobiles.
